如何搭建共享文件伺服器
『壹』 辦公室如何搭建共享伺服器或文件共享伺服器
隨意你,共享就好了,都不好意思找你要銀子。
『貳』 Win7下搭建ftp伺服器實現文件共享
步驟1、控制面板-程序-打開或關閉Windows功能,或者在開始菜單里搜索"打開或",彈出Windows功能窗口,勾選Internet信息服務下的FTP功能和Web管理工具,以此開啟服務。點擊確定後,需要等幾分鍾。
溫馨提示:必須選中Web管理工具而且全部展開選中,否則僅僅開啟FTP功能無法繼續調用IIS管理器
步驟2、在控制面板-系統和安全-管理工具,或直接在開始菜單搜索"Internet信息服務(IIS)管理器"。
溫馨提示:只有進行了上一步打開功能的操作後,管理工具才會出現這一項,否則開始菜單搜索也是無法搜索到的。
步驟3、打開ISS管理器,右鍵點擊你的伺服器,選擇"添加FTP站點"。
步驟4、再添加你的FTP站點名稱、選擇你要共享的路徑。
步驟5、在下拉菜單中選擇你內網的IP作為IP地址,埠默認。勾選"自動啟動FTP站點,SSL選擇無或允許皆可。"
步驟6、選擇匿名訪問,根據需求選擇允許訪問的用戶。根據需求選擇是否允許讀取、寫入。
溫馨提示:一般情況下Win7用戶上傳到在Win7下自建的Ftp伺服器文件超過30MB,Win7伺服器會因為負荷太重導致掉線,可能由於Win7的優先順序太高,傳輸時佔用了伺服器的所有帶寬而導致伺服器資源耗盡。所以盡量選擇不允許寫入。
在Win7下搭建FTP伺服器後,就可以實現計算機中的文件共享,方便又便攜。
註:更多請關注電腦教程欄目,三
聯電腦辦公群:189034526歡迎你的加入
『叄』 如何搭建ftp伺服器實現文件共享
1、點擊開始,控制面板,程序,打開或關閉Windows功能,或者在開始菜單里搜索"打開或",彈出Windows功能窗口,勾選Internet信息服務下的FTP功能和Web管理工具,以此開啟服務。點擊確定後,需要等幾分鍾。(必須選中Web管理工具而且全部展開選中,否則僅僅開啟FTP功能無法繼續調用IIS管理器)
2、在控制面板-系統和安全-管理工具,或直接在開始菜單搜索"Internet信息服務(IIS)管理器"。
3、打開ISS管理器,右鍵點擊你的伺服器,選擇"添加FTP站點"。
4、再添加FTP站點名稱、選擇要共享的文件夾路徑。
5、在下拉菜單中選擇當前的IP作為IP地址,埠默認。勾選"自動啟動FTP站點,SSL選擇無或允許皆可。"
6、選擇匿名訪問,根據需求選擇允許訪問的用戶。根據需求選擇是否允許讀取、寫入。
7、設置完成後FTP伺服器就建好了,就可以實現計算機中的文件共享,方便又便攜。
『肆』 公司怎麼建立共享盤
1、滑鼠右鍵點擊文件夾,然後選擇屬性。
『伍』 怎麼組建一個公司的文件共享伺服器
1、打開控制面板所有控制面板項網路和共享中心更改高級共享設置。
『陸』 如何在windows8/7中建立WebDAV伺服器實現訪問或共享文件
WebDAV是一種類FTP的協議,你可以用它在互聯網上遠程訪問或共享你的文件。與FTP相反,WebDAV可以更好地通過防火牆,並且有密碼保護和加密。我們馬上就來介紹一下如何在Windows中建立WebDAV伺服器。
首先,你必須安裝互聯網信息服務(IIS)和WebDAV publishing。在Win7中,點擊「開始」,輸入「Windows features」,然後按下回車。在Win8中,在開始屏幕上,輸入「Windows features」,選擇右邊的「設置」,然後選擇出現的快捷方式。
務必要選擇以下幾項:
● 互聯網信息服務(IIS)
● IIS管理控制台
● WebDAV publishing
● Windows身份驗證
下一步,要開啟WebDAV publishing,你必須打開IIS管理器。在Win7中,點擊「開始」,輸入「IIS」,然後打開出現的快捷方式。在Win8中,在開始屏幕上,輸入「IIS」,然後打開出現的快捷方式。
要配置Windows身份驗證,選擇「Default Web Site」並雙擊「Authentication」圖標。顯示的身份驗證類型列表會根據你之前安裝的類型出現,但如果你只是將IIS用來使用WebDAV,我建議禁用「匿名」並開啟「Windows身份驗證」。
下一步,再次選擇「Default Web Site」並雙擊「WebDAV Authoring Rules」,然後單擊右邊的「Enable」。之後點擊右邊的「Add Authoring Rule」,配置許可權和你要的選項。
要測試IIS和網頁伺服器是否運行,打開一個瀏覽器並輸入「localhost」,按回車。
如果你開啟了Windows身份驗證,會提示你輸入用戶名和密碼,請在這里輸入你Windows賬號的名稱和密碼。如果登錄有問題,請確認你的賬戶名正確——打開「計算機管理控制台」,查看本地用戶列表進行確認。
驗證完成後,你就會看到默認IIS頁面,如果你沒刪除或改動的話。
要測試WebDAV伺服器是否起作用,打開命令行提示窗口,輸入: net use * http://localhost。它會把網路驅動器映射到你的WebDAV文件夾,顯示出你IIS網頁伺服器目錄下的文件。
如果你想給其他地方提供訪問許可權,你可以添加一些虛擬目錄。右鍵單擊「Default Web Site」,選擇「Add New Virtual Directory」。
為了讓你或他人通過互聯網訪問WebDAV伺服器共享,你必須配置防火牆,打開「80」埠,用於未加密訪問,打開「443」埠,用於加密訪問,並且配置路由器的相應埠。正確配置好後,要通過互聯網訪問WebDAV,你要使用互聯網IP地址或者是域名或主機名。
在使用Windows身份驗證時,你的WebDAV密碼是加密的,如果你選擇使用普通的80埠的HTTP的話,會話的其他部分是明文發送的。但你也可以通過在IIS中開啟SSL加密,並在配置/訪問WebDAV共享時使用HTTPS地址,來對整個會話進行加密。
如果你想在瀏覽器中看到你的文件列表,在IIS中打開「Directory Browsing」,選擇「Default Web Site」,雙擊「Directory Browsing」,點擊右邊的「Enable」。
『柒』 Ubuntu 16.04 搭建 NFS 文件共享伺服器
伺服器端需要安裝 nfs-kernel-server 軟體包:
$ sudo apt-get update
$ sudo apt-get install nfs-kernel-server
默認情況下,NFS 伺服器上定義了某個共享目錄,則該目錄及其子目錄下的所有文件都可被訪問。
出於對安全的考慮,客戶端任何需要 超級用戶 (即 root 用戶,UID=0 & GID=0)許可權的文件操作都默認映射到 UID=65534 和 GID=65534 的用戶,即 Ubuntu 系統中的 nobody:nogroup。
例如客戶端使用 root 許可權在掛載的共享目錄中創建文件時,該文件的 屬主 和 屬組 自動變為 nobody:nogroup ,而非 root:root 。
sudo mkdir -p /var/nfs/gernel
sudo mkdir -p /var/nfs/public
sudo chown nobody:nogroup /var/nfs/gernel
為了使 NFS 伺服器定義的共享文件可被指定的客戶端主機訪問,需要在伺服器端的 /etc/exports 文件中添加對應的記錄。
該文件的格式如下:
Directory Host(Options ...) Host(Options) #comment
關於 /etc/exports 文件的詳細語法格式可參考 man exports 。
文件示例:
列出 nfs 伺服器上的共享目錄
創建掛載點
sudo mkdir -p /mnt/nfs/gernel
sudo mkdir -p /mnt/nfs/public
sudo mkdir -p /mnt/nfs/starky
掛載遠程目錄
sudo mount 192.168.56.102:/var/nfs/gernel /mnt/nfs/gernel
sudo mount 192.168.56.102:/var/nfs/public /mnt/nfs/public
sudo mount 192.168.56.102:/home/starky /mnt/nfs/starky
許可權測試
NFS 的許可權設定基於 Linux 文件系統的許可權管理,即客戶端掛載遠程共享目錄後,會把它們當成本地磁碟目錄一樣對待,也是根據文件的屬主(組)及其對應的許可權設定來限制訪問。
gernel 目錄的屬主(組)為 nobody:nogroup(65534:65534),所以雖然該目錄為讀寫許可權,非 root 用戶無法執行新建操作。而 root 用戶由於 NFS 默認的安全機制,會自動映射到 nobody:nogroup。
由於我在客戶端和服務端都有一個名為 starky 的用戶,且它們的 UID:GID 都為1000:1000,所以服務端的 /home/starky 目錄可以直接被客戶端的 starky 用戶訪問。且由於 no_root_squash 選項,通過 sudo 命令創建的文件其屬主仍為 root(而不會再映射為 nobody)。
當然這會導致一些安全問題,比如多個客戶端同時都有 UID(GID)為1000的用戶(不管用戶名是什麼),則這些用戶會共享服務端 /home/starky 目錄里的文件許可權。
可編輯 /etc/fstab 文件令掛載共享目錄的 mount 操作成為系統的固定配置(手動輸入的 mount 命令屬於臨時掛載,重啟會自動卸載),使得系統重啟後可以自動掛載遠程文件系統。 /etc/fstab 文件的示例內容如下:
/etc/exports 文件的格式為: Directory Host(Options ...) Host(Options) #comment
其中的 Host 項用來指定可訪問對應共享目錄的主機,其格式可分為以下幾種:
傳輸協議
最初的 NFSv2 由於性能原因使用 UDP 協議,雖然 NFS 添加了自己的 包序列重組 和 錯誤檢查 功能,但 UDP 和 NFS 都不具備 阻塞控制 演算法,所以在大型的互聯網路環境中缺乏足夠的性能。
NFSv3 提供了 UDP 和 TCP 協議之間的選擇。NFSv4 只能使用 TCP 協議。
隨著 CPU,內存等硬體設備和網路傳輸速度的提高,最初由於性能需求而傾向 UDP 協議的選擇也變得不再必要。
State
NFSv2 和 NFSv3 是 無狀態 的連接,服務端不會跟蹤客戶端對共享目錄的掛載情況,而是使用 "cookie" 來記錄一次成功的掛載。"cookie" 不會因為伺服器重啟而刪除,可以用來在伺服器掛掉之後保留客戶端的連接信息。
NFSv4 是 有狀態 的連接,客戶端和服務端都會維護文件操作紀錄及文件鎖的狀態。所以不再需要 "cookie" 的使用。
文件鎖
早期版本的 NFS 協議(v2 & v3)由於是 無狀態 的連接,它們並不清楚哪些主機正在使用哪些文件。但是文件鎖的實現又需要獲取狀態信息。所以早期協議中的文件鎖是獨立於 NFS 實現的。
而 NFSv4 將文件鎖的實現整合到了核心協議中,雖然此舉增加了復雜度,但同時也解決了早期版本中的很多問題。
但是為了兼容使用 V2 和 V3 協議的客戶端,獨立的 locked 和 statd 守護進程仍舊需要。
安全相關
NFS 協議最初在設計時並不關注安全性,NFSv4 通過引入對更強大的安全服務和身份驗證的支持,加強了該協議的安全性。
傳統的 NFS 協議大多使用 AUTH_SYS 驗證方式,基於 UNIX 的用戶和組標識。在這種方式下,客戶端只需要發送自己的 UID 和 GID 並與伺服器上的 /etc/passwd 文件內容作對比,以決定其擁有怎樣的許可權。
所以當多個客戶端存在 UID 相同的用戶時,這些用戶會擁有相同的文件許可權。更進一步,擁有 root 許可權的用戶可以通過 su 命令切換到任意 UID 登錄,伺服器會因此給予其對應 UID 的許可權。
為了防止上面的問題出現,伺服器可選擇使用更健壯的驗證機制比如 Kerberos 結合 NFS PRCSEC_GSS。
NFS 共享目錄的訪問控制基於 /etc/exports 文件中定義的主機名或 IP 地址。但是客戶端很容易針對其身份和 IP 地址造假,這也會導致一些安全問題。
NFSv4 只使用 TCP 作為自己的傳輸協議,而且通常只開放 2049 埠進行數據傳輸。在配置防火牆時,除了放開 2049 埠的限制外,還要時刻注意數據傳輸的源地址和目標地址。
win10 系統默認不能掛載 NFS 共享目錄,需要進入 控制面板 - 程序 - 程序和功能 - 啟用或關閉 Windows 功能 ,勾選上 NFS 服務 。
UNIX and Linux System Administration Handbook, 4th Edition
How to Mount an NFS Share Using a Windows 10 Machine
『捌』 如何建立公司文件共享伺服器
有哪位高人能夠告訴我,如何建立公司內部的文件共享系統。要求是公司員工(大約直接在文件共享伺服器建立共享文件夾,設定共享密匙,在需要共享的客戶機做
『玖』 如何使用Serv-U搭建一個80人文件共享伺服器
1、創建一個文件夾。
2、右擊——屬性——共享添加EVERYONE勾選所有許可權。
3、安全選項卡里也添加EVERYONE勾選所有選項。
4、然後在安全選項卡那裡找到高級按鈕點擊進去。
5、出現許可權選項卡,找到EVERYONE這一項。點擊編輯按鈕。
6、出現對象選項卡,找到「應用到」這行,有下拉菜單按鈕,選擇」只有該文件夾」選項。然後確定。
7、退回到許可權選項卡界面,選擇應用後確定。
8、回到屬性選項卡確定。
9、如果你是域環境,那麼你會發現你的文件夾屬性里會有這幾個許可權:1、administrators 2、10、Domain users 3、CREATOROWNER 4、Everyone
11、然後設置Domain users的安全屬性,設置為:1、讀取也運行2、列出文件夾目錄3、讀取。
然後選擇文件夾屬性里的共享選項卡。
12、繼續添加另外一個用戶組Domain users,只給讀取的許可權,應用確定。